:LOL: :LOL: "Odyssey opposed this application on the grounds that the proposed service would be directly competitive with Odyssey Television Network. It further claimed that approval of this application will create further competition for the acquisition of broadcast rights for Greek-language programming, especially in view of the fact that Odyssey itself has filed applications for two Greek-language Category 2 specialty programming undertakings. In particular, Odyssey noted that, due to a significant increase in licence fees for the programs from Mega, Odyssey had been forced to drop that programming. The intervener stated that it would experience more such situations if ECGL’s application were approved"
